Common senior care questions in Orting, WA

Senior care in Orting, WA refers to a range of services designed to support older adults with daily activities, health needs, and independence. Families often compare caregiver profiles based on experience, services offered, and availability to find the right fit. Many begin by exploring local senior care options to understand what level of support is needed.

Senior care services in Orting, WA can range from in-home support to more structured care environments. Common options include companionship, personal care, and help with daily activities, as well as specialized services like memory care or recovery support such as post surgery care. Some families may also explore residential options like assisted living depending on their needs.

The average rate for senior care providers in Orting, WA as of July, 2026 is $29.10 per hour. Costs can vary depending on the level of care required, the caregiver’s experience, and the number of hours needed. Many families review factors like scheduling and how to pay for in-home care when planning ongoing support.

Home health aides and certified nursing assistants (CNAs) both support seniors in Orting, WA, but their training and responsibilities can differ. Home health aides typically assist with personal care and daily activities, while CNAs may have additional medical training and can provide more hands-on clinical support.
